Abstract

China has the largest number of hearing-impaired people in the worldover millions of Chinese suffered from hearing-impaired. However, most television programs don't offer Chinese subtitles or the sign language, leaving the hearing disabled people unable to obtain the information and enjoy recreational activities as ordinary people do. Therefore, the sign language on television is very important. Comparing to the ordinary computer, the calculation and processing power of the digital TV terminals is nowhere near a computer. Small storage space and low performance restrict the ability of displaying 3D graphics on the television. Therefore, this article uses a 3D graphics mesh simplification method which based on edge collapse, to simplified 3D graphics, and apply it to the sign language on the digital television, to achieve the goal of displaying the 3D sign language graphics smoothly and intuitively on the digital TV terminals.
